Hakimpur - Kadipur, Sultanpur

Hakimpur is a village situated in the Kadipur tehsil of Sultanpur district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 28 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kadipur and around 70 km from the district headquarters in Sultanpur. Hakeempur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Hakimpur village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Hakimpur is 171181. The village covers a total geographical area of 166.38 hectares and falls under the 224232 pincode. Dostpur is the nearest town, located about 15 km away.

Hakimp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Kadipur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Sultanp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Hakimpur

As per Census 2011, Hakimpur village has a total population of 1,214 people, consisting of 636 males and 578 females. The village has 157 households and a sex ratio of 908 females per 1,000 males. There are 187 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 721 literate and 493 illiterate residents. Additionally, 176 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Hakimpur

Hakimp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Malipur, while the nearest airport is Lal Bahadur Shastri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 75.3 km.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Dostpur to Hakimpur is about 15 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Sultanpur to Hakimpur is about 70 km, with the usual travel time around ~2 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
